CARAMEL-APPLE PORK CHOPS



Caramel-Apple Pork Chops image

Bacon, walnuts, pork chops and a scrumptious caramelized apple and onion mixture. How could anyone resist this fall family pleaser? Best of all, it cooks in one skillet, so cleanup is easy! -Taste of Home Test Kitchen

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 35m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

4 bacon strips, chopped
4 boneless pork loin chops (6 ounces each)
3 small tart apples, peeled and thinly sliced
1 medium onion, chopped
4 teaspoons brown sugar
1 tablespoon butter
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1/2 cup chicken broth
2 packages (6 ounces each) fresh baby spinach
3 tablespoons chopped walnuts, toasted

Steps:

  • Cook bacon in a large skillet over medium heat until crisp. Remove to paper towels; drain, reserving 3 teaspoons drippings. In the same skillet, cook pork chops in 2 teaspoons reserved drippings over medium heat for 2-3 minutes on each side or until lightly browned. Remove and keep warm., Saute apples and onion in 1 teaspoon reserved drippings in the same skillet until apples are crisp-tender. Stir in the brown sugar, butter, salt, cinnamon and pepper. Add broth; bring to a boil. Add pork chops.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 4-5 minutes or until a thermometer reads 145°., Remove chops to serving platter; let stand for 5 minutes. Add spinach to skillet and cook until wilted. Serve with chops. Sprinkle with bacon and walnuts.

PORK CHOPS WITH APPLES AND ONIONS



Pork Chops with Apples and Onions image

Sauteed apples and onion combine with pork chops for a tastiness that never disappoints.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Meat & Poultry     Pork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 bone-in pork chops (loin or shoulder), cut 3/4 inch thick
Coarse sal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il or vegetable oil
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 large white onion, sliced
2 to 3 apples, cored and sliced (about 3 cups)
1 cup beer, white wine, cider, or chicken broth

Steps:

  • Trim the chops of excess fat. Sprinkle generously with salt and pepper on both sides. Heat a 14-inch cast-iron skillet (if you have a smaller one, you'll need to work in batches) over high heat, and then swirl in the olive oil. Lay in the pork chops and don't move them for a few minutes, to assure a good golden sear forms. Turn and brown well on the second side for a total of about 10 minutes. Transfer the chops to a warm plate.
  • Swirl the butter into the pan. Add the onion and apples. Saute until the onion slices are lightly caramelized and the apples have begun to soften, about 8 minutes. Stir in the beer or other liquid. Return chops to the pan.
  • Cook until the pork is tender, about 15 more minutes (depending on the size of the chops), turning halfway through and covering the chops with the apple mixture. If the apple mixture needs a little thickening, transfer the chops to the warm plate again and simmer the mixture on high for a few minutes to reduce. Serve the chops over rice or mashed potatoes with a large spoonful of the apple-onion mixture over the top.

PORK CHOPS AND APPLES



Pork Chops and Apples image

Here's an easy-to-make dish that's perfect when you're cooking for two!

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Entree

Time 50m

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 4

1 medium unpeeled cooking apple, sliced
2 tablespoons packed brown sugar
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
2 bone-in pork rib chops, about 3/4 inch thick (about 1/4 pound each)

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350°F. Place apples in 1 1/2-quart rectangular casserole. Sprinkle with brown sugar and cinnamon. Cover with foil; bake 15 minutes.
  • Trim fat from edge of pork. Spray 8- or 10-inch nonstick skillet with cooking spray; heat over medium heat 1 to 2 minutes. Cook pork in hot skillet about 6 minutes, turning once, until light brown.
  • Place pork in single layer on apples. Cover and bake 10 to 12 minutes or until pork is no longer pink when cut near the bone, meat thermometer reads 145°F and apples are tender.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 220, Carbohydrate 26 g, Cholesterol 45 mg, Fat 1/2, Fiber 2 g, Protein 15 g, SaturatedFat 2 g, ServingSize 1 Serving, Sodium 30 mg, Sugar 23 g, TransFat 0 g

PORK CHOPS AND APPLES



Pork Chops and Apples image

Sweet and sour-tasting pork with apples.

Provided by shorembo

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Pork     Pork Chop Recipes

Time 35m

Yield 5

Number Of Ingredients 11

5 pork chops
salt and ground black pepper to taste
¼ cup all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on ground cumin
1 tablespoon oil, or as needed
2 apples - peeled, cored, and thinly sliced
1 cup chicken broth
4 tablespoons red wine vinegar
2 tablespoons honey
2 tablespoons ketchup
2 tablespoons finely chopped shallot

Steps:

  • Season pork chops with salt and pepper. Dredge in flour and cumin and shake off excess.
  • Heat o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Saute pork chops until browned, about 5 minutes per side. Transfer to a plate. Add apples; cook and stir just until tender, about 2 minutes. Transfer to a plate. Add broth, vinegar, honey, ketchup, and shallot to the skillet and cook for 1 minute.
  • Return pork and apples to the skillet, cover, and cook until pork is only slightly pink in the center, about 10 minutes more.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 326.9 calories, Carbohydrate 22.8 g, Cholesterol 71.4 mg, Fat 13.1 g, Fiber 1.6 g, Protein 29 g, SaturatedFat 4.4 g, Sodium 373.3 mg, Sugar 14.4 g

PORK CHOPS WITH CURRIED CARAMELIZED ONIONS AND APPLES



Pork Chops with Curried Caramelized Onions and Apples image

A cozy dish that will warm you all over and make your home smell fantastic! Butter-caramelized onions and apples combined with curry powder, applesauce, and a little garlic make this a fantastic dinner with mashed potatoes!

Provided by EdsGirlAngie

Categories     Pork

Time 1h45m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

4 center-cut pork chops, 3/4 to 1 inch thick
olive oil (for browning chops)
salt and pepper
4 tablespoons butter
1 onion, diced
1 large apple, diced and cored
1 1/2 cups unsweetened applesauce
1 cup apple juice
1 cup beef broth
1 clove garlic, minced
2 tablespoons ground curry powder, to taste
more sal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Season chops with salt and pepper; brown both sides in a skillet with a little olive oil; remove to a 9x13 inch baking dish.
  • In the same skillet, melt butter over medium heat.
  • Cook and stir onions and apples in butter until caramelized, being sure to stir up browned bits.
  • Stir in applesauce, apple juice, beef broth, garlic and curry powder.
  • Season to taste with salt and pepper; simmer on low heat until slightly thickened, continuing to stir up browned bits from pork chops.
  • Pour apple-onion mixture over chops in baking dish and cover dish with foil.
  • Bake in a preheated 400 degree oven for 45 minutes.
